Hosea 11:3

Yet it was I who guided Ephraim [the northern kingdom—as a father teaches his son to walk],
and I who took them in my arms,
but they did not acknowledge
that I had healed them.

The hebrew text BETA

Hebrew Masoretic text (MA), Read from right to left

וְאָנֹכִי   תִרְגַּלְתִּי   לְאֶפְרַיִם   קָחָם   עַל   זְרוֹעֹתָיו   וְלֹא   יָדְעוּ   כִּי   רְפָאתִים  

Greek Septuagint (LXX), Read from left to right

καὶ ἐγὼ συνεπόδισα τὸν Εφραιμ ἀνέλαβον αὐτὸν ἐπὶ τὸν βραχίονά μου καὶ οὐκ ἔγνωσαν ὅτι ἴαμαι αὐτούς
